Fanxiang Meng is a scholar working on Atmospheric Science, Civil and Structural Engineering and Ecology, Evolution, Behavior and Systematics. According to data from OpenAlex, Fanxiang Meng has authored 51 papers receiving a total of 563 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 17 papers in Atmospheric Science, 9 papers in Civil and Structural Engineering and 9 papers in Ecology, Evolution, Behavior and Systematics. Recurrent topics in Fanxiang Meng's work include Climate change and permafrost (14 papers), Cryospheric studies and observations (10 papers) and Soil and Unsaturated Flow (7 papers). Fanxiang Meng is often cited by papers focused on Climate change and permafrost (14 papers), Cryospheric studies and observations (10 papers) and Soil and Unsaturated Flow (7 papers). Fanxiang Meng collaborates with scholars based in China, Germany and Switzerland. Fanxiang Meng's co-authors include Qiang Fu, Renjie Hou, Tianxiao Li, Mo Li, Qinglin Li, Dong Liu, Tianxiao Li, Deping Liu, Qinglin Li and Ji Yi and has published in prestigious journals such as Angewandte Chemie International Edition, Energy & Environmental Science and PLoS ONE.
